What are some key Bible verses about family harmony?
Many scriptures address the importance of family unity and peaceful co-existence. Some of the most impactful include:
-
Ephesians 5:22-33: This passage emphasizes the roles of husbands and wives within a marriage, focusing on mutual respect, submission, and love. The husband is called to love his wife as Christ loved the church, and the wife is called to respect her husband. This mutual respect and love are fundamental building blocks for a harmonious home. It's not about dominance or subservience, but about a collaborative partnership built on love and understanding.
-
Colossians 3:12-15: This section encourages putting on compassion, kindness, humility, meekness, and patience. These qualities are crucial for resolving conflicts and fostering forgiveness within the family. Holding onto bitterness or resentment only damages relationships. Forgiving each other, as Christ forgave us, is essential for maintaining harmony.
-
Proverbs 17:1: "Better a dry morsel with quiet than a house full of feasting with strife." This verse highlights the value of peace over material possessions. A home filled with constant arguing and conflict is far less fulfilling than a simpler life lived in harmony.
-
Proverbs 15:1: "A soft answer turns away wrath, but a harsh word stirs up anger." This emphasizes the importance of communication. Choosing our words carefully and responding with gentleness can defuse tense situations and prevent escalating conflicts.
How can I apply Bible verses to improve my family relationships?
Applying these principles isn't always easy. It requires conscious effort, self-reflection, and a willingness to change. Here are some practical steps:
-
Pray together: Shared prayer strengthens family bonds and unites hearts. Praying for each other's needs and for guidance in navigating challenges can create a deeper sense of connection and understanding.
-
Practice active listening: Truly hearing each other's perspectives, without interrupting or judging, is crucial. Understanding each family member's feelings and needs fosters empathy and compassion.
-
Forgive readily: Holding onto grudges only breeds resentment. Forgiving each other, as Christ forgave us, is vital for maintaining a peaceful home environment.
-
Spend quality time together: Dedicated family time, free from distractions, strengthens bonds and creates lasting memories. Shared activities, meals, or simply talking together can significantly improve family relationships.
-
Seek professional help: If you're struggling to resolve conflicts on your own, seeking professional help from a counselor or therapist can be beneficial. They can provide guidance and tools to improve communication and build stronger relationships.
What if my family doesn't share my faith?
Sharing your faith with your family is a personal journey. Lead by example, demonstrating the love and forgiveness described in the Bible through your actions. Focus on building positive relationships based on mutual respect and understanding. While you can share your beliefs, avoid forceful conversions or judgment. Your actions will speak louder than words.
